Loaksoft engine is weaker than Gambittiger but it is still not close to beginner
level.
Beginners do tactical mistakes and give pieces when loaksodt engine does not do
it even in the lowest beginner level.

I think that depth 2 is lower level then the lowest beginner level and even this
level does not do stupid tactical mistakes so beginners have no chance against
it.

I am sure that the weakest beginner level of loaksoft can get more than 1900 in
blitz.
